Chocolate Kahlua Toffee Trifle
- 1 box devil's food cake mix
- 1 (6 ounce) package instant chocolate pudding mix
- 2 cups milk
- 1 cup Kahlua
- 16 ounces Cool Whip or 16 ounces fresh whipped cream
- 1 package Skor English toffee bits or 6 Skor candy bars, crushed up
- Prepare cake according to the box.
- Set aside to cool.
- Cut the cake up into cubes.
- Combine pudding mix, milk and Kahlua.
- If it is too runny, set it aside in the fridge to allow it to thicken for 20 minutes.
- It will make it easier to work with.
- To assemble, use a pretty straight-sided glass bowl or trifle bowl.
- Layer the bottom with 1/2 the cake cubes making sure to line the sides of the bowl.
- I usually like to cut a few rectangular pieces to line the side with and then fill the inside with the cubes.
- Pour 1/2 the the pudding over the the cake layer making sure to spread it to the side of the bowl so you can see the layer.
- Spread 1/2 the Cool Whip on top of the pudding mix in the same manner.
- Sprinkle 1/2 the Skors bits on top of the Cool Whip.
- Repeat the layering with the rest of the ingredients ending with the Skors bits on top.
- Chill overnight before serving.
